c语言循环语句(c语言循环语句都有什么?)
c语言全部循环语句?
I)for循环的一般形式是:
For (lt初始化gtlt条件表达式gtlt增量gt)
声明;
初始化总是一个赋值语句,用来给循环控制变量赋初值;
条件表达式是确定何时退出循环的关系表达式;
每次循环后循环控制变量的变化是增量定义的。三。
组件之间使用;单独使用。
例如:
for(I=1 lt=10i)
声明;
(while循环的一种形式是:
While(条件)
声明;
While循环表示当条件为真时将执行该语句。直到条件不成立。
结束这个循环。然后继续循环程序外的后续语句。
例如:
# includestdio。h
main0
{
字符c
C=#340#34/正在初始化c*/
而(c!=#34
#39)/汽车已完成循环*/
C=getcheQ/带回从键盘接收的显示字符*/
(C)do-while循环的一般格式是:
做
{
报告模块;
}
While(条件);
这个循环不同于while循环:它首先执行循环中的语句。
这样就可以判断条件是否成立,如果成立,就继续循环;
结束循环。因此,do-while循环必须至少执行一条-secondary循环语句。
类似地,当有多个语句参与循环时,将它们括起来。
扩展:C语言改变循环状态
1.使用break语句提前终止循环。
通用形式
布莱克;
这个过程就是让这个过程跳出循环,然后执行循环下的语句。
Break语句只能在break语句和switch语句中使用,不能单独使用。
2.c语言使用continue语句提前结束这个循环。
继续的通常形式;
这样做是为了结束这个循环,即跳过循环体下尚未执行的语句,进入循环的结尾。
3.中断和继续的区别
continue语句只是结束这个循环,而不是整个循环的执行。break语句是整个循环过程的结束,不再判断执行循环的条件是否有效。
c语言循环语句都有什么?
(for循环的一般形式是:
For (lt初始化gtlt条件表达式gtlt增量gt)
声明;
初始化总是一个赋值语句,用来给循环控制变量赋初值;
条件表达式是确定何时退出循环的关系表达式;
每次循环后循环控制变量的变化是增量定义的。三。
组件之间使用;单独使用。
例如:
for(I=1 lt=10i)
声明;
(while循环的一种形式是:
While(条件)
声明;
While循环表示当条件为真时将执行该语句。直到条件不成立。
结束这个循环。然后继续循环程序外的后续语句。
例如:
# includestdio。h
main0
{
字符c
C=#340#34/正在初始化c*/
而(c!=#34
#39)/汽车已完成循环*/
C=getcheQ/带回从键盘接收的显示字符*/
(C)do-while循环的一般格式是:
做
{
报告模块;
}
While(条件);
这个循环不同于while循环:它首先执行循环中的语句。
这样就可以判断条件是否成立,如果成立,就继续循环;
结束循环。因此,do-while循环必须至少执行一条-secondary循环语句。
类似地,当有多个语句参与循环时,将它们括起来。
扩展:C语言改变循环状态
1.使用break语句提前终止循环。
通用形式
布莱克;
这个过程就是让这个过程跳出循环,然后执行循环下的语句。
Break语句只能在break语句和switch语句中使用,不能单独使用。
2.c语言使用continue语句提前结束这个循环。
继续的通常形式;
这样做是为了结束这个循环,即跳过循环体下尚未执行的语句,进入循环的结尾。
3.中断和继续的区别
continue语句只是结束这个循环,而不是整个循环的执行。break语句是整个循环过程的结束,不再判断执行循环的条件是否有效。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。